WebOct 12, 2024 · Green computing, also called sustainable computing, aims to maximize energy efficiency and minimize environmental impact in the ways computer chips, … WebComputers and office equipment consumed 253 billion kWh of electricity in 2012, 24% of the total electricity consumption of office buildings that year. 9. In 2014, U.S. data centers consumed 70 billion kWh of electricity—1.8% of total electricity consumption. 2. The peak power associated with servers and data centers in 2007 was 7 GW.
